I bought it three years ago, now the mileage is already over 20,000. It is a Lada 21065 from 1997. The car holds the road perfectly, both on wet and dry asphalt. Aquaplaning is absent. Wear resistance is good, after three seasons, the digital wear indicator has worn off by one digit from 8 to 7. Excellent tire. It handles the road perfectly, the steering has become more sharp. It's not afraid of ruts, it easily copes with them. When braking from 60 km/h on wet asphalt, it barely slips into a skid, rarely, and only in the last 30 centimeters of the braking distance. Very pleased!

I bought my wife a set of Hakka i3 tires for her Toyota IST, but it's impossible to balance all four wheels with more than 50g of weight on each one. The casting is naturally uneven. I've been working with cars for about 15 years and I have five cars, so I don't need to be told about square disks and other things.
